TURKEY, ISTANBUL: Dolmabahce Palace was finished in 1855 for Sultan Abdul Mecit, whereupon the sultan and his household, abandoning Topkapi Palace, which had been the imperial residence for four centuries. It has a fantastic garden and also tea gardens around it.
